Incident Overview: What Happened?
According to the Las Vegas Review-Journal, the collision occurred during the evening hours when the driver, suspected to be under the influence, lost control and crashed into the power pole. This strike resulted in a series of power outages affecting both homes and businesses in the vicinity. Utility companies quickly mobilized to assess the damage and restore services, with reports indicating that thousands were left without electricity for several hours.
As first responders secured the area, they conducted sobriety tests on the driver, whose actions have raised questions about the ongoing battle against impaired driving. Despite the severity of the situation, authorities noted that no serious injuries were reported, which is a silver lining in an otherwise troubling scenario.
